Positives and negatives of Hiring a Headhunter
The major question you need to answer prior to when you hire a headhunter to help you with a job search is “are headhunters your friend or foe?” Keep in mind headhunters can be part of a recruiting firm but they don’t work for you – they only work for the company that will hire you. As a job seeker, you want to be at the top of the list of desirable candidates, certainly when the job market has become so cut throat.
One evident advantage of working with a reputed headhunter or recruiting firm is that you have superb chances of ending up in a workplace that is best suited to your skills. Professional headhunters completely grasp the exact specifications and consideration of the recruiting firm, therefore, they contact the right group of people.
If you are looking for a job in a specific industry or sector, it is more beneficial that you contact a headhunter who specializes in the exact same area. It is important that the person or recruiting firm you contact has a good notion about the dynamics of your field. You can then receive beneficial information about the company you will potentially join before you are selected. This will also help you get familiar with the line of work you are about to get in.
You can also hire a headhunter to help you fix your resume. Since you are dealing with a professional service to help you with your job search, you will be charged for this work. You may have to pay the fee up front, while some headhunters and recruiting firms ask you to pay only after you get a job. The second option proves to be better in a sense that you can continue searching for the job on your own.
If you are in search of a specialized job and you hire a headhunter, you can be deceived with dream jobs that just don’t exist. For that reason, you need to be vigilant when dealing with headhunting services or recruiting firms and before you proceed with the fee payment.

Gas Facts For Apprentices
In some jobs, you just need to get out there and get your hands dirty. Theory is all fine and well, of course, but you need to be able to focus on real technical skills to avoid mistakes and risks. In a potentially risky job such as that involving gas, this has never been truer. An apprenticeship, or modern apprenticeship, as they are often known, is full of technical content which is perfect in a potential risky position such as that of a gas engineer! At first, you’ll be dealing with cookers, fires and central heating systems for both homes and businesses.
And you do need decent training if you want to work in the gas industry, learning and becoming certified in the basics of installation, service and repair. You’ll be working towards registration on the Gas Register, which anyone needs before they get to full-time work, and is what the apprenticeship is built around. All the while you are training, you’ll be earning. The national minimum wage for apprentices is currently 2.60 per hour, although you could earn more depending on who you work for. Upon qualification, a gas engineer will then usually earn a starting salary between 17-28,000.
Your training doesn’t have to end when you’ve completed your apprenticeship: many people go on to study intermediate and advanced levels of gas system maintenance and repair, which can also include designing and laying pipes. The UK gas network is always expanding, and you could find yourself playing a key role in a major part of one of the country’s infrastructures.
Once you’re qualified, job prospects are usually very good, as most gas suppliers need the skills that an apprenticeship will have trained you in. As a gas engineer, you’ll need good technical ability and focus, together with IT skills and the ability to work equally comfortably on both outdated and ultra-modern gas systems.
You’ll need to be very safety-minded, too – and it’s worth having good people skills for dealing with puzzled customers.

Job Interview Questions and Answers – What’s Your Greatest Achievement?
Job interview questions that ask you to describe or share your greatest achievement or accomplishment is the perfect opportunity for you to present your knowledge, skills and abilities as the perfect match for the job.
This job interview question is one of the few where you can legitimately brag about all that you have to offer and use your answer to demonstrate why you and only you are the perfect match for the job.
The key is to develop a strategic answer that showcases your accomplishments but is also relevant to the employer or the position you are interviewing for. The majority of job seekers make the mistake of simply sharing their accomplishments without making sure it’s relevant for the job.
Use these 3 tips to answer the question to position you as the best person for the job.
First, be sure you have reviewed the job description thoroughly to get a clear understanding of what your job responsibilities are going to be. You have to know the job inside out so you know what type of “achievements” they will be most impressed by.
Next, prepare your list of past achievements that you are proud of and showcase you in your best light. Which of these do you feel would be most relevant to the job you are interviewing for? Think about it. If the job requires customer service experience, pick one of your accomplishments where you exceeded a customer’s expectations and got an award for it.
Prepare an example ahead of time so you are ready to tell the story in an interesting and engaging way. This will give them evidence that backs up your claims and shows them what they can expect from you when they hire you.
Finally, end with a statement that ties together your past achievement to your future performance once they hire you for the job. You do this to highlight that you can achieve a similar stellar performance for them.
You should position it as a preview of what you can do in the future. Once you have demonstrated your potential, you should be ready to say “when you hire me for this job, I will be able to accomplish the same thing in this role by…”
There is no Hiring Manager who can resist you when you can clearly show the type of results you can get for them. After all, if you have achieved it in the past, you can do it again.
Job interview answers must be strategic so you can position yourself ahead of everyone else.

Small Claim Judgment Recovery
Even after winning your court case in small claims, one’s nightmare has not ended. Unfortunately, the court does not collect on the awarded debt. There is no debtor’s prison to threaten the defendant with. The plaintiff winter is left to his or hers own devices to collect the monies owed them.
You may have an issue with someone about a contract, an accident, non-compliance, child or spousal support, personal injury compensation, or any number of legal issues; you’ll want to collect damages. Collecting on this award means everything if one wants to put an end to the problem.
Enforcing a court ordered judgment is the only way to collect what is owed. It’s reported that eighty to eighty-five percent of all awarded judgments are not collected.
Court order funds need to be located and grabbed in order to implement this process. A judgment professional insider’s business course will help one locate bank accounts, hidden investments, tax refunds, business income, safe deposit boxes, real estate, autos, boats or any asset that they have legal authority to seize.
Since only 20 percent of court awarded claims are collected on, it’s obvious that most plaintiffs never follow through. Hiring a lawyer is likely out of the question since the charge big hourly fee and requires sizable retainers. An Information Subpoena obligates a debtor to list all sizeable assets, and with the right written forms, one can begin the collection process by mail.
By collecting money yourself or on behalf of a client by using proper forms, one can efficiently collect that court awarded money. There is no need for a permit or collection license because you’re not going to be collecting funds for someone else. Because you are temporarily assigned the award, you will be collecting the judgment for yourself. It is the matter of completing a simple form.
The necessary information provided by the Information Subpoena gives direction to the creditor for enforcement. One has the possibility of having the sheriff enforce the collection of the identified assets by seizing them and selling them at auction in order to recover the money.

Different Kinds Of Cooks
Eating places, hotels and also other food provider companies often employ three individual kinds of employees; chefs, , and food preparing personnel.
Chefs take care of directing the activities of additional food workers, menu planning, recipe making, food and supply purchasing, and several certain cooking functions. They may be often just about the most senior participants in the personnel.
Cooks take care of the day to day meals preparing for the establishment or site. According to the size of your facility, there might be a variety of cooks, each liable for a different section of the meal, or a different type of meals. To illustrate, there are fry cooks, veggie cooks, pastry cooks, and other specialties.
Food Preparing Personnel act below the supervision of chefs and also cooks, and often perform less skilled obligations. For example, some might chop produce, put together salads, make ready supplies being used by the restaurant’s chefs and cooks.
Chef and Cook Job Duties While chefs and cooks share comparable obligations, chefs typically have more training versus cooks, such as cooking qualifications. The core obligations performed by a chef, cook, or food preparing person often is dependent upon the sort of place of business that requires them. For example, a significant establishment, hotel, or resort can have all types of personnel, with separate employes for varying food product types. A smaller sized establishment could have just one cook or chef, and a few helpers. In this instance, the cook will be accountable for preparation of most types of meals. Together with being separated by food specialty, chef and cook job titles are occasionally determined by the type of practice that employs these individuals.
Institutional cooks work in hospitals, cafeterias, and also other establishments that commonly serve an everyday clientele. Short order cooks work in restaurants that emphasize rapid customer service, and are also qualified to prepare numerous types of items swiftly. There is a small market for domestic cooks, who may have the full kitchen responsibility, including food preparation, cleaning, and diet preparing, for a family unit.
